Bombay High Court Confirms Death Sentence for Father Who Murdered Pregnant Daughter for Inter-Caste Marriage. The court upheld the conviction under Sections 302, 316, and 364 IPC, finding the murder to be a premeditated honour killing falling within the 'rarest of rare' category.

Bombay High Court Confirms Death Sentence in Kidnapping, Rape, and Murder of Minor Girl - Accused's Appeal Dismissed. Circumstantial evidence including last seen theory and medical evidence held sufficient to sustain conviction under Sections 364, 366, 376, 377, 302, 201 IPC.

Bombay High Court Dismisses Writ Petition Challenging Detention Under MPDA Act — Preventive Detention Upheld as Legally Valid. Court holds that subjective satisfaction of detaining authority based on credible material is sufficient and not vitiated by delay in disposal of representation.

Bombay High Court Dismisses Petition Seeking CBI Investigation in Murder Case Due to Lack of Exceptional Circumstances. Court holds that mere allegations of inadequate investigation do not warrant transfer of investigation to CBI or constitution of SIT under Article 226 of the Constitution of India.

Bombay High Court Quashes COFEPOSA Detention Order Due to Unexplained Delay. Preventive detention under Conservation of Foreign Exchange and Prevention of Smuggling Activities Act, 1974 set aside as live nexus between smuggling activity and detention order snapped by 10-month delay.

Bombay High Court Quashes Process Against Accused in Domestic Violence Case Due to Lack of Territorial Jurisdiction. Complaint Filed at Nandurbar While Incident Occurred at Tenbhurne, Buldhana District, Violating Section 177 Cr.P.C.
